- (continued from previous page)Q: A bonic of bread and a sheet full of crumbs
A: The moon and starsQ: As white and as yellow as red and as green the King could not touch it nor neither the Queen. The Pope in his room could touch it as soon, riddle me that from morn till noon?
A: The RainbowQ: Little white Nancy, with the little red nose; the longer she lives the shorter she grows
A: A candleQ: As I went up to Dublin I saw a terrible wonder four and twenty blackbirds tearing the earth asunder
A: A HarrowQ: A half a moon a whole hill. A little town in Ireland stands still
A: MohillQ: Round and round the rugged rocks the rugged rascals ran. If you tell me how many r's in that you will be a clever man.
A: NoneQ: What is most like half a cheese
A: The other halfQ: A houseful and a roomful, and you could not catch a spoonful
A: Smoke(continues on next page)- Collector
